Key Features
- Fabric blend: A 75% polyamide and 25% elastane mix gives a silky, smooth hand feel and reliable four-way stretch for movement and comfort.
- Deep side pockets: Two roomy pockets keep a phone, cards and keys secure while walking, golfing or running errands.
- Adjustable fit: An elastic waistband with a drawstring allows simple on-the-go adjustment for a comfortable waist fit.
- 7/8 ankle length: The cropped ankle cut delivers a sporty, energetic look that pairs easily with sneakers or casual flats.
- Versatile wear: The design works equally well for athletic use, travel, work-casual outfits and home lounging.

Specifications
| Brand | G GRADUAL |
| Fabric | 75% polyamide, 25% elastane |
| Fit feature | Elastic waistband with adjustable drawstring |
| Pocket style | Two deep side pockets |
| Length | 7/8 ankle length |
| Intended uses | Golf, travel, casual wear, work, lounge, yoga, athletics |
